<p>Plan on attending the 113th annual Family Fall Festival Sunday, September 12 for great food, fun and entertainment! The day kicks off with a special worship service in the Chapel of St. John the Beloved at 10:00 a.m. Then, from 11:30 a.m. – 5:00 p.m., head outside to enjoy this year’s festival on the Lutheran Home campus, 800 W. Oakton Street, Arlington Heights, Illinois. Admission is free and festival highlights include the Walter Flechsig German Band, crafts, pony rides, a classic car show, and the Murley Shertz Band.</p>
<p>Everyone is welcome!</p>

<p>The Lutheran Home, for the 2nd straight year, was awarded first place in the commercial division of Arlington Heights’ acclaimed Frontier Days Parade. One of the largest Independence Day parades in the Midwest, this year’s July 5th parade theme focused on Volunteerism. The Lutheran Home’s “hands that serve, hearts that care” entry highlighted the thousands of hours donated every year by residents, teens, neighbors and staff at the Lutheran Home.</p>

<p>Not too many people remember what life was like around the Lutheran Home without the caring presence and cheerful smile of Susan Brandt. Since 1968, Susan has faithfully served Lutheran Home residents and their families as a Certified Nurse’s Assistant and Certified Family Partner.</p>
<p>Sue’s experience and insight have been blessings to the community and hundreds, possibly thousands, of Arlington Heights neighbors. Sue has decided, after 41 years of serving others in their retirement years, to start her own retirement years. She is excited to travel and spend extended time pursuing her interests.</p>
<p>Lutheran Home colleagues celebrate Susan Brandt. Sue’s friends at the Lutheran Home are thankful for the opportunity to serve alongside her, be mentored by her, and wish her great happiness in her retirement.</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>The Lutheran Home, a Lutheran Life Community in Arlington Heights now offers a new orthopedic rehabilitation wing. Just like all areas of care at the Lutheran Home, this 12 person unit features all-private rooms. Each room is equipped with a flat-screen TV, new furniture, lighting, and carpeting. Visiting family members and friends are enjoying comfortable, newly furnished social areas in which to relax, snack and converse. Rehab guests have access to a private courtyard as well as seven-day-a-week professional therapy services in the rehabilitation unit’s designated fitness center. The centralized location of this new unit means it’s very close to the Lutheran Home’s General Store and Oakton Square Deli, convenient places to share a cup of coffee or an ice cream sundae with friends and family.</p>
<p>The Lutheran Home rehabilitation unit features in-room dining. The call-in delivery service features extended meal hours and a bistro-style menu with a variety of delicious, made-to-order dishes. Rehab guests are invited to enjoy regularly-scheduled daily activities and participate in special events, such as monthly birthday parties, church services, entertainment and luncheons.</p>
<p>Professionals from Alliance Rehab are highly trained therapists who work with the individual and their doctors to create rehab plans and exercises that best suit them. Therapists are assigned patients and accompany them throughout the entire recovery process, from pre-surgery, preparatory therapy to inpatient therapy and, finally, to outpatient services.</p>
<p>Throughout its services, Lutheran Life Communities faithfully provides care with whole health focus &#8211; social, spiritual, and of course, physical.
